Schedule of quantitative information about significant unobservable inputs
 The following table sets forth quantitative information about the significant unobservable inputs used to measure the fair value of the Company’s mortgage loans as of June 30, 2015:

 

Input

 

Range of Values

Equity discount rate – Re-performing loans   8% - 14%
Equity discount rate – Non-performing loans   10% - 18%
Cost of debt   4.25%
Loan resolution timelines – Re-performing loans (in years)   4 - 7
Loan resolution timelines – Non-performing loans (in years)   1.4 - 4
